PG电子源码解析与开发指南pg电子源码
本文目录导读:
随着电子技术的快速发展,PG电子源码作为现代电子设备的核心部分,其重要性日益凸显,PG电子源码不仅决定了电子设备的功能和性能,还直接影响到设备的稳定性和可靠性,本文将从PG电子源码的基本概念、开发流程、常见问题及解决方案等方面进行详细解析,帮助读者全面了解PG电子源码的相关知识。
PG电子源码的基本概念
PG电子源码是指用于描述和控制PG电子设备的代码,PG电子设备可以是各种类型的电子设备,如微控制器、嵌入式系统、工业控制设备等,PG电子源码通常以C语言或汇编语言编写,用于实现设备的控制逻辑、数据处理和通信功能。
PG电子源码的核心部分包括以下几个方面:
- 控制逻辑:用于实现设备的基本功能,如输入输出控制、状态机切换等。
- 数据处理:用于处理设备的输入数据和输出数据,包括数据的采集、处理和传输。
- 通信协议:用于实现设备之间的通信,如串口通信、CAN通信、以太网通信等。
- 中断处理:用于处理设备中的中断事件,如传感器检测到异常信号时的处理。
PG电子源码的编写需要具备扎实的电子电路知识和编程技能,在编写PG电子源码时,需要注意以下几点:
- 模块化设计:将复杂的功能分解为多个模块,每个模块负责实现一个特定的功能。
- 代码优化:尽量简化代码,减少不必要的操作,提高代码的执行效率。
- 注释说明:在代码中添加注释,以便他人能够理解代码的功能和作用。
PG电子源码的开发流程
PG电子源码的开发流程大致可以分为以下几个阶段:
- 需求分析:在开发PG电子源码之前,需要对设备的功能和性能进行详细的分析,明确开发目标和功能需求。
- 系统设计:根据需求分析的结果,进行系统的功能划分和模块设计,确定各模块之间的接口和通信方式。
- 代码实现:根据系统设计的模块划分,编写各个模块的代码,并进行集成。
- 测试与优化:在代码实现后,进行功能测试、性能测试和稳定性测试,发现问题并进行优化。
- 部署与维护:在测试通过后,将代码部署到目标设备上,并进行日常的维护和更新。
在每个阶段中,都需要仔细规划和协调,确保开发过程的顺利进行。
PG电子源码的常见问题及解决方案
在PG电子源码的开发过程中,可能会遇到各种各样的问题,以下是一些常见的问题及解决方案:
-
功能冲突:在代码实现过程中,不同模块之间的功能可能会产生冲突,导致设备无法正常工作。
- 解决方案:可以通过增加判断条件或使用优先级机制来解决功能冲突问题。
-
性能问题:在代码优化过程中,可能会导致代码的执行效率下降。
- 解决方案:可以通过使用优化编译器、减少不必要的操作和简化数据处理流程来提高代码的执行效率。
-
数据库设计不合理:在嵌入式设备中,数据库的设计可能会对PG电子源码的性能产生影响。
- 解决方案:需要对数据库的设计进行详细的规划和优化,确保数据库的查询和更新操作能够高效地进行。
-
通信问题:在设备之间的通信过程中,可能会出现通信失败或数据传输不准确的问题。
- 解决方案:可以通过增加错误检测机制、使用更可靠的通信协议或优化通信参数来解决通信问题。
PG电子源码的优化与维护
在PG电子源码的开发过程中,代码的优化和维护是一个关键环节,代码优化的目标是提高代码的执行效率和可维护性,而代码维护则是确保代码能够长期稳定地运行。
-
代码优化:代码优化可以通过以下方式实现:
- 使用最佳实践和编程规范,确保代码的可读性和可维护性。
- 使用代码审查和静态分析工具,发现代码中的潜在问题。
- 使用编译器优化选项,提高代码的执行效率。
-
代码维护:代码维护可以通过以下方式实现:
- 使用版本控制工具(如Git),管理代码的版本和历史。
- 建立详细的代码文档,记录代码的功能、接口和使用方法。
- 定期进行代码审查和测试,确保代码的稳定性和可靠性。
PG电子源码作为现代电子设备的核心部分,其重要性不言而喻,通过本文的详细解析,我们了解了PG电子源码的基本概念、开发流程、常见问题及解决方案,以及代码优化和维护的重要性,在实际开发过程中,需要注意模块化设计、代码优化和注释说明,以确保代码的高效性和可维护性,希望本文能够为读者提供有价值的参考,帮助他们在PG电子源码的开发过程中取得成功。
PG电子源码解析与开发指南pg电子源码,
发表评论